: Find the trigonometric functions of theta if the terminal side of theta passes through (4,-3). This question is from textbook Basic Technical Mathematics

With sides 4 and 3 the hypotenuse is 5 because,
5%5E2=4%5E2%2B3%5E2
using the Pythagorean theorem.
The angle has the properties,
sin%28A%29=-3%2F5
cos%28A%29=4%2F5
A=-36.9=323.1
